Pittsburgh Author Florance W. Biros
Author Florence W. Biros discusses her book-turned-movie, “Dogjack”. The feature film is the story of a dog from Pittsburgh who became a Civil War hero. “Dogjack” makes its debut during a special screening at Soldiers and Sailors Hall and Museum in Pittsburgh’s Oakland community.
